Bnei Menashe return to Israel

In late November, the Israeli government made a decision that will forever change the lives of more than 5,000 people of Israelite descent living in the remote hills of northeastern India. Their oral traditions trace their ancestors back to the Assyrian exile of 722 BCE, when the northern tribes of Israel were scattered across the ancient Near East.

There are Gypsies in Israel?

Domari Kids Living in Israel

Like Romani Gypsies, the Domari people have been known historically as traveling musicians and dancers, with their own language, beliefs, and traditions. Their nomadic origins trace back to India. They have historically faced discrimination and social exclusion across the Middle East, including in Israel.
